Rekeying locks
Rekeying a lock requires changing the key that is in use to a new one but keeping the lock. This option is beneficial for a variety of reasons. Perhaps you have lost keys, or moved into a new house. Whatever the reason, rekeying locks is an excellent method to make sure that nobody is able to gain access to your home without the proper key. To rekey your lock, first disassemble it. Then, replace the key pins or "tumblers." This will make your old key incompatible with the new one.

If you're looking to replace the door lock you'll need to think about the cost of changing the key. In most cases it is a DIY keying project requires only a screwdriver. It can be completed in less than an hour. Most new locks come with comprehensive instructions and hotlines for customer support. A lot of major lock manufacturers offer Rekeying kits that are simple to use and cost around $15. The cost of an expert rekeying service is around $160.

Picking a reliable locksmith
When choosing a locksmith you must be aware of how the business operates and how friendly their customer service is. You might consider looking for an alternative company if you feel they are unprofessional. If they're professional or friendly, it's crucial to feel at ease giving them access to your personal property and home. Be sure that the locksmith is properly insure. If the locksmith is injured while working on your property the insurance will cover both of you and the locksmith.
Be wary of businesses which advertise low rates in their advertisements. Typically, they won't tell you what their real costs are until you ask them. Make sure you ask for an exact estimate over the phone prior to hiring a locksmith. Even if they claim to be the cheapest, they'll never tell you the full service cost, costs for parts, and labor costs. A reputable locksmith will give a quote over the phone, which includes all these factors along with the cost.
Another way to determine the right locksmith is to search online reviews. Check out customer reviews and client ratings to decide which ones are worth the time and effort. It is always better to work with locksmiths with a stellar reputation rather than one with a poor.
